> At the request of the WG Chairs, as well as many other members of the IETF
> community, we we will be implementing TDMA in front of all ietf.org mailing
> lists. We plan to put this in place tomorrow, Tuesday May 6th, at
> approximately 17:00 GMT / 1pm ET.
>
> The setup will use one common whitelist for all the lists. The whitelist
> will be pre-seeded with all the current regular subscribers to any of the
> mailing lists on ietf.org.  People who aren't subscribed to any list will be
> required to confirm their first posting. In order to both keep the size of
> the whitelist reasonable, and to regularly clean out entries for robots, we
> plan to let non-subscriber entries on the whitelist time out after 6 months,
> which will mean that non-subscribers will need to acknowledge a posting
> every 6 months or so.
